There's two varieties of clay deposits: Key and secondary. Primary clays type as residual deposits in soil and continue to be at the internet site of formation. Secondary clays are clays read more which have been transported from their initial location by water erosion and deposited in a whole new sedimentary deposit.
Together with agricultural Advantages, clay contributes into the pure filtration of water. As h2o percolates by way of clay soil, impurities and contaminants are trapped, thereby purifying groundwater materials. This essential assets has implications for sustainable drinking water management and conservation initiatives.
